I don't have PN but CRPS, a close cousin I suppose...and have survived multiple foot operations and major nerve damage. My physical medicine and rehabilitation specialist was opposed to me personally going into a brace except as a last resort. They help hold position but will contribute to atrophy since you are no longer doing the work yourself. I would council moderation and a PT consult. There must be exercises that you can do to help keep the muscles stimulated and the nerves getting motor signal. Consider doing aquatherapy so gravity is not also an issue. You can really get a lot of muscle work and stimulation in the water. I should know, I was non-weightbearing on crutches for nine months and on a scooter for a year.

Keep at it no matter what and don't give up hope. For the longest time all the reps I did on PT exercises seemed to go nowhere but they were preventing further loss. Eventually, oh it was slow, I did start to build some muscle back. It took months but sometimes stubbornness is a virtue!
